5. SYMPTOM:THEDISPLAYSOFTHECONSOLEDONOT FUNCTION PROPERLY
a. The console requires three 'AA" batteries (not
included); alkaline batteries are recommended. If
the displays of the console do not function prop-
edy, the batteries should be replaced. Open the
battery cover as shown at the right. Press three
batteries into the battery compartment, with the
negative (-) ends of the batteries touching the
springs. Close the battery cover.

6. SYMPTOM: ONE OFTHE UPPER BODY ARMS SQUEAKS DURING USE
a. Correcting this problem requires a small amount of white marine
grease, available at most department stores.
Turn the Resistance Knob (101) counterclockwise untilit can be
removed. Remove the Resistance Cone (100) and the Upper
Body Arm (102), along with the Resistance Washers (108),
Spring Washer (t 11), Thrust Washers (109), and Thrust Bearing
(110). (Note: Ifthe Resistance Sleeve [99] comes out ofthe
Resistance Bracket [97], press itback in.) Apply a thin layer of
white marine grease tothe outer surface of the Resistance Cone
(100). Reattach all parts in the order shown at the right.
